Distributed Practice
Spacing the study of material to be remembered by including breaks between study periods.
Cramming
An intensive, short-term study technique characterized by long hours of continuous study just before an exam.
Spacing Studying
The practice of distributing learning sessions or practice over time, rather than condensing them into short blocks, to improve long-term memory retention.
Hindsight Bias
The tendency to believe, after an event has occurred, that one would have predicted or expected the event, often referred to as the "I-knew-it-all-along" phenomenon.
